Set within the iconic Ziggurat House development, this well-presented two-bedroom first floor apartment offers stylish, modern living in one of St Albans’ most sought-after central locations. The property boasts a generous layout and the rare advantage of a large private balcony, perfect for relaxing, entertaining or enjoying outdoor space rarely found in apartment living.
Inside, the apartment features a bright open-plan living and dining area with double doors that enhance the sense of light and space. The contemporary fitted kitchen is sleek and well-designed, offering ample storage and integrated appliances.
There are two well-proportioned bedrooms, both offering comfortable accommodation, along with a modern bathroom finished with quality fittings.
Residents of Ziggurat House benefit from lift access, secure entry systems, and allocated parking, as well as beautifully maintained communal areas.
Ideally positioned just moments from St Albans City station and the vibrant city centre, this apartment is perfect for commuters, first-time buyers, and investors seeking a stylish home in a highly convenient location.
